Maxicus Agency logo

Maxicus

BPO & Outsourced Support Website

Maxicus offers customer lifecycle management, omnichannel customer support, phygital virtual shopping, tech support, back-office support, data annotation, and customer service automation. The agency provides support in 10+ languages and focuses on seamless customer engagement across all touchpoints.

Moryaas Digital Agency logo

Moryaas Digital

BPO & Outsourced Support Website

Moryaas Digital is a Mumbai-based call center and technology services agency founded in 2008. The company provides custom solutions to reduce cost and improve efficiency, serving SaaS, mobile apps, and out-of-the-box tech services.
